The moon rotates about its axis once per 27.3 days, which is the same amount of time it takes to complete one orbit around Earth. This is why we only see one side of the moon from Earth.

The imaginary line in which the Earth rotates is called its axis. The Earth's axis is tilted at an angle of approximately 23.5 degrees with respect to its orbit around the Sun, which causes the changing seasons.
